About Swatch Group

The Swatch Group, a leading global player in the watchmaking industry, is renowned for its diverse portfolio of prestigious brands. As an employer, the Group offers a dynamic and innovative environment, fostering creativity and excellence across its operations. Headquartered in Biel/Bienne, Switzerland, The Swatch Group is committed to sustainability and technological advancement, making it an attractive workplace for professionals seeking to make a significant impact in the luxury sector.

Role & Responsibilities

  • Oversee and manage brand protection strategies and initiatives.
  • Lead online intellectual property enforcement efforts.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ure brand integrity.
  • Provide legal counsel on matters related to brand protection and IP enforcement.
  • Develop and implement policies to safeguard the company's intellectual property.

Qualifications

  • Juris Doctor (JD) or equivalent legal degree.
  • Admission to practice law in relevant jurisdiction.
  • Extensive experience in brand protection and IP enforcement.

Skills

Strong analytical and strategic thinking abilities. Excellent communication and negotiation skills. Proficiency in legal research and documentation. Ability to work collaboratively in a team-oriented environment.

Experience

A minimum of 7 years of experience in legal counsel roles, with a focus on brand protection and intellectual property enforcement.

Education

Juris Doctor (JD) or equivalent legal degree.
